Adapting Journalism to the New News Ecology

Principles identified by Journalism That Matters participants at Poynter Institute

* If it's for the public good, it's good (who, what and how is less important)

* Journalism is now entrepreneurial

[edit] Part two

* The new ecology is collaborative. We all have a role.

* Fact-based information networking that inspires civic engagement
